In this way, Does sauerkraut make you fart?

Due to the high probiotic content of fermented foods, the most common side effect is an initial and temporary increase in gas and bloating ( 32 ). These symptoms may be worse after consuming fiber-rich fermented foods, such as kimchi and sauerkraut.

Is refrigerated sauerkraut better than canned?

Refrigerated sauerkraut still contains live probiotics. It is therefore considered to be better than canned sauerkraut as the canning process often involves pasteurization.

What does it mean if my fart smells like rotten eggs?

Your gas may smell like rotten eggs because of the sulfur in fiber-rich foods. Sulfur is a natural compound that smells like spoiled eggs. Many vegetables are sulfur-based. If this is causing your flatulence, a simple change in diet will be sufficient treatment.

Why do you fart more as you get older?

As you get older, your body makes less lactase, the enzyme needed to digest dairy products. So, over time, you may have more gas when you eat cheese, milk, and other dairy products. Medications. Some prescriptions cause constipation or bloating, which can also lead to more flatulence.

How long will sauerkraut keep after opening?

If you are refrigerating your sauerkraut, it should stay fresh for about four to six months after opening.

Does sauerkraut in a jar go bad?

Properly stored, unopened canned sauerkraut will generally stay at best quality for about 3 to 5 years, although it will usually remain safe to use after that. … Discard all canned sauerkraut from cans or packages that are leaking, rusting, bulging or severely dented.
